java如何调出日历

java如何调出日历

作者:Joshua Lee发布时间:2026-01-31阅读时长:0 分钟阅读次数:1

用户关注问题

Q
如何在Java程序中显示一个日历控件?

我想在Java应用程序中添加一个日历控件,方便用户选择日期,应该怎么实现?

A

使用Java Swing的JCalendar组件

在Java中,可以使用第三方库如JCalendar来实现日历控件。先下载JCalendar库并导入项目,然后通过创建JCalendar实例添加到Swing界面中。这样用户就能通过图形界面选择日期,简化日期输入。

Q
Java标准库有没有直接支持的日历组件?

Java自带的库中是否有现成的日历控件可以调出来使用?

A

标准Java库没有图形化日历控件

Java标准库(如Swing或AWT)本身没有直接提供图形化的日历组件。需要开发者自己实现,或者借助第三方的日历控件库,比如JCalendar、LGoodDatePicker等,这些库能够提供丰富的日历功能及易用的接口。

Q
如何使用Java代码获取当前日期并格式化?

我想用Java代码调出当前日期并显示为易读格式,有什么推荐做法?

A

借助java.time包格式化当前日期

可以使用Java 8及以上版本提供的java.time包中的LocalDate和DateTimeFormatter类,首先获取当前日期(LocalDate.now()),然后用DateTimeFormatter按照需要的格式进行格式化输出。这种方式可以方便地处理和展示日期信息。